Transaction 34456a75ecd4ef30c1307fc9941f1284efe1dd5e9cc8a132913fb03af249046a

1 Input
2 Outputs
  • 34456a75ecd4ef30c1307fc9941f1284efe1dd5e9cc8a132913fb03af249046a:0
  • value  6386752
    address  1HXRRFfHKVd9SWWJ8siNxEDsdSW1QaBbVt
  • 34456a75ecd4ef30c1307fc9941f1284efe1dd5e9cc8a132913fb03af249046a:1
  • value  107157377
    address  bc1qpnndaj9v2r2tphyfl9pmv2tzptrq0fcxwz0nrk